A self declaration letter is a written statement where you declare something to be true. It’s like a formal way of saying, "I confirm this information." There are many situations where you might need one, such as when applying for something or resolving a problem. Why is a Self Declaration Letter Important?
A self declaration letter is important for several reasons. It can provide documentation when other official documents aren’t available. It can also establish credibility when you need to confirm something.
- **Official documentation:** It serves as a substitute when standard paperwork is missing.
- **Confirmation:** It confirms details needed for application/claim.
- **Legal Standing:** It establishes a record of your declaration.
The key is accuracy and honesty. A self declaration letter’s strength lies in its truthfulness. Without truthfulness, the letter becomes invalid and may lead to legal issues. Always keep a copy of the self-declaration letter for your records.
- Make sure the letter is clear and concise.
- State exactly what you are declaring.
- Use your full name and contact information.

Example: Self Declaration Letter for Employment (Missing Documents)
Subject: Self-Declaration – Missing Educational Documents
Dear [Hiring Manager Name],
I am writing to formally declare that I am unable to immediately provide copies of my educational certificates for employment purposes. My original documents are currently [state the reason: e.g., with the university for verification, in transit, etc.].
I completed my [Degree Name] at [University Name] in [Year of Graduation]. I can provide additional details to verify my education such as [Mention other supporting documents e.g., transcript, previous offer letters]. I will submit the documents as soon as I receive them, which I expect to be within [Number] days. Please contact me at [Your Phone Number] or [Your Email Address] if you require any further clarification.
Thank you for your understanding.
Sincerely,
[Your Full Name]
[Your Address]
Example: Self Declaration for Address Proof
Subject: Self-Declaration – Proof of Address
To Whom It May Concern,
I, [Your Full Name], residing at [Your Full Address], hereby declare that this is my current residential address. I have been living at this address since [Start Date].
I am using this declaration as proof of address because [State the reason: e.g., I do not have utility bills in my name, I am in a temporary accommodation, etc.].
If you require any further information, please do not hesitate to contact me at [Your Phone Number] or [Your Email Address].
Sincerely,
[Your Full Name]
Example: Self Declaration for Marital Status
Subject: Self-Declaration – Marital Status
Dear [Recipient Name/Organization, if any],
I, [Your Full Name], hereby declare that my current marital status is [Single/Married/Divorced/Widowed]. [If married: My spouse’s name is [Spouse’s Full Name] and we were married on [Date of Marriage].]
[If divorced/widowed: I was divorced on [Date of Divorce] / My spouse passed away on [Date of Death].]
This declaration is made for [State the Purpose: e.g., visa application, employment, etc.].
You can reach me at [Your Phone Number] or [Your Email Address] for any further inquiries.
Sincerely,
[Your Full Name]
Example: Self Declaration for Name Change
Subject: Self-Declaration – Name Change
To Whom It May Concern,
I, [Former Full Name], residing at [Your Address], hereby declare that my legal name has been changed to [Your New Full Name]. This change was legally effected on [Date of Name Change] through [Mention the legal process: e.g., a court order, gazette notification, etc.].
All documents and records under my former name, [Former Full Name], now pertain to me, [Your New Full Name].
You can contact me at [Your Phone Number] or [Your Email Address] if you have any questions.
Sincerely,
[Your New Full Name]
Example: Self Declaration for Financial Support
Subject: Self-Declaration – Financial Support
Dear [Recipient Name/Organization, if any],
I, [Your Full Name], residing at [Your Address], hereby declare that I am providing financial support to [Name of Person Receiving Support], who resides at [Address of Person Receiving Support].
I provide [State the type of support: e.g., regular financial assistance, covering expenses, etc.] to [Name of Person Receiving Support]. The amount of support is approximately [Amount] per [Period: e.g., month, year].
This declaration is made to [State the Purpose: e.g., support an application, proof of income, etc.]. You can reach me at [Your Phone Number] or [Your Email Address].
Sincerely,
[Your Full Name]
Example: Self Declaration for Experience or Skills
Subject: Self-Declaration – Skills and Experience
To Whom It May Concern,
I, [Your Full Name], hereby declare that I possess the following skills and experience: [List of Skills and Experience].
[Provide details for each skill or experience, including the duration, where you gained it, and what you achieved. For example: “I have 5 years of experience in web development, working with HTML, CSS, and Javascript. I built and maintained [website name] and increased user engagement by [percentage].”]
This declaration is made for [State the purpose: e.g., Job application, project proposal, etc.]. You can reach me at [Your Phone Number] or [Your Email Address] if you have any questions.
Sincerely,
[Your Full Name]
